Former #1 Tennessee Commit Dylan Brooks Leaves For Different SEC Program.....
Dale Zanine-USA TODAY Sports
Four-star, Top 100 defensive end/outside linebacker recruit out of Alabama, Dylan Brooks, was released from his letter of intent to Tennessee football on Friday. He will now be taking his talents to Auburn... (The Spun)
